Canon SX400 IS vs Panasonic FH10 Physical Comparison

For anyone who is looking to lug around your camera regularly, you will have to consider its weight and volume. The Canon SX400 IS has got outer measurements of 104mm x 69mm x 80mm (4.1" x 2.7" x 3.1") accompanied by a weight of 313 grams (0.69 lbs) and the Panasonic FH10 has sizing of 94mm x 54mm x 18mm (3.7" x 2.1" x 0.7") having a weight of 103 grams (0.23 lbs).

Canon SX400 IS vs Panasonic FH10 Sensor Comparison

Oftentimes, it is difficult to see the gap between sensor measurements purely by looking at a spec sheet. The visual below may provide you a greater sense of the sensor measurements in the SX400 IS and FH10.

As you can see, both of these cameras have the same sensor dimensions and the same exact resolution and you should expect similar quality of images but you will need to factor the release date of the products into consideration. The more modern SX400 IS is going to have a benefit when it comes to sensor innovation.
